This book tells the story of Maverick Carter and what happened when he was stuck with a baby at 17, then how his second baby Starr was conceived. It also discussed how he got into and then chose to leave the gang his dad used to run.

For the most part, I really loved this story. It was very inspiring to have Maverick working his way back up after multiple bad decisions and deciding what to do with his life.

There were other aspects of this book that I thought were unnecessary. Some things felt like they didn't need to be included, and I thought this book could have been a decent bit shorter.

I also had a problem with the treatment of unprotected sex within this book.

I finished this book last night, after starting it when I woke up yesterday morning--which should tell you something about how much I liked it I guess. I've loved every book Angie Thomas has written, and this was no exception. You can definitely read this without having read The Hate U Give, but obviously you should read that anyway, and I do think you get a richer experience reading this one if you've read THUG.
